1100 hrs long haul flights equals roughly 200 landings/approaches, that you shared with your captain (since I presume you have no command time).
So 100 landings/approaches for you?
See, 1500TT does not really mean much:hmm:
Many (many...) more chances with some command time, even on a much lighter equipment.
